Imaging of glucose uptake in MO5 cells with Glucose Uptake Probe-Green or 2-NBDG

Glucose Uptake was visualized with high sensitivity using Glucose Uptake Probe-Green compared with 2-NBDG.

Reduction of Glucose uptake in 3LL cells with a drug that inhibits the glycolytic system


Glucose uptake in 3LL cells was decreased with compound X, which inhibits the glycolytic system.

Glucose uptake in E. coli and C. elegans

Imaging of glucose uptake in E. coli with Glucose Uptake Probe-Green

Imaging of glucose uptake in C. elegans Intestine with 2-NBDG or Glucose Uptake Probe-Green


Glucose uptake in E. coli and C. elegans was observed with Glucose Uptake Probe-Green

Glucose Uptake in astrocytoma U-251 MG Cells after X-ray Irradiation for 3 hours.


Reduction of glucose uptake by X-ray irradiation was observed using Glucose Uptake Probe-Green
